Board-like SCR denitration is environmental protection rising industry, perfect along with national environmental protection policy, and its market potential is huge, and this technology is first grown up by Japan at late 1970s and the beginning of the eighties, is promoted in Europe and the U.S. rapidly thereafter.Board-like SCR denitration main component generally comprises nano-TiO
2, V
2o
5and WO
3.Shared by these three kinds of compositions, catalyst ratio is more than 95 ﹪, and pug or powder raw material are mainly coated on stainless steel expansion web by board-like Catalyst Production after batch mixing, kneading, through section, shaping, vanning, is finished product finally by the calcining of continuous calcining stove.The board-like catalyst of SCR denitration is mainly used in the denitration engineering of the industry flue gases such as electric power, metallurgy, building materials.Plate-type denitration catalyst complete series product has high denitration efficiency, high performance of anti-blockage, high resistance flying dust erosion performance, low SO
2conversion ratio, low NH
3the excellent specific properties such as escapement ratio, low pressure loss and good anti-poisoning capability, are widely used in the denitrating flue gas environment of high dust.Can there is slight jitter when flue gas is by catalyst in the veneer of flat catalyst, can prevent thin ash from piling up on a catalyst.Stainless steel aperture plate skeleton structure, antiwear property is strong, more resistance to flying dust corrosion.
Because this SCR plate-type denitration catalyst is vertical calcining, air stratification can be avoided like this, but the hot air circulation of whole torus has 180o to turn in whole flow field, it is uneven that hot blast after turning enters catalyst prod, some positions hot blast rate is large, and some places hot blast rate is little, often easily makes catalyst plates decorated fire, not only greatly affect product quality, even also there will be many waste products.

The technical solution of the utility model is: it arranges and to form circulating air chamber by being arranged on calcining furnace burner hearth both sides and top between dividing plate and inwall and be arranged on the airtight hot air circulation duct that the product carrying case inner catalyst product etc. on chassis forms, bottom product carrying case, be provided with the sieve plate putting catalyst prod, and be provided with air inlet duct between sieve plate and chassis.These air inlet duct both sides are all provided with two pieces of split-wind plates and are divided into three layers of branch air duct, and make circulating air evenly enter each interval gap of catalyst prod, the air outlet that air inlet duct both sides air inlet is arranged with bottom, calcining furnace Inner eycle air channel communicates.
The beneficial effects of the utility model are: owing to being provided with sieve plate bottom the product carrying case on chassis, and split-wind plate is provided with in air inlet duct, thus make from the chassis that circulation air path air outlet docks is separated after three layers of air intake evenly send into different intervals, the air intake in each interval is again through sieve plate equal wind again, most relief hot blast enters product from bottom to top equably, thus it is consistent to ensure that product often puts heat, only need control EAT and intake well, just fully can ensure that the burning quality of product, improve board-like catalyst activity.

As shown in Figure 1, wind apparatus is divided to be to form circulating air chamber 8 between dividing plate 10 and inwall by arranging in calcining furnace 9 burner hearth both sides and top and be arranged on the airtight hot air circulation duct that the product carrying case 7 inner catalyst product 6 etc. on chassis 5 forms for SCR board-like catalyst vertical continuous calcining furnace chassis, the sieve plate 4 putting catalyst prod 6 is provided with bottom product carrying case 7, and air inlet duct 11 is provided with between sieve plate 4 and chassis 5, these air inlet duct 11 both sides are all provided with upper and lower two pieces of split-wind plates 3 and are divided into three layers of branch air duct, circulating air is made evenly to enter each interval gap of catalyst prod 6, the air outlet 1 that air inlet duct 11 both sides air inlet 2 is arranged with bottom, calcining furnace 9 Inner eycle air channel 8 communicates.When implementing the utility model, calcining furnace 9 is provided with circulating air chamber 8, exported 1 by the hot-air after heating by the wind of hot bottom, circulating air chamber in circulating air chamber and enter air inlet duct 11 above chassis 5, bottom air inlet 2 place to be divided into product carrying case 7 that multiply hot blast enters on chassis 5 by split-wind plate 3, each is interval, then by just entering each the interval gap being placed in product carrying case 7 inner catalyst product 6 after sieve plate 4 again equal wind, uniform calcination is carried out to product.Due to sieve plate 4 having a lot of sieve aperture, product every nook and cranny can be flowed to equably by the hot blast behind sieve plate hole, not have dead angle and occur.SCR plate-type denitration catalyst is it is crucial that its activity, uniform temperature field is very important to the calcining of catalyst, the utility model have rational in infrastructure, make the advantages such as simple, easy for installation, dividing equally property is good, fully can meet the technological requirement of product calcining, ensure the quality of catalyst prod, stop to occur waste product.
